Publication number: 20140324226Abstract: Various operational mode arrangements of an electric toothbrush (10) include pre-programming a controller portion (16) of the electric toothbrush such that a single brushing event of approximately two minutes comprises automatically at least two different operating modes and specified times for each mode. Another operational mode includes the capability of operating the on/off button (20) of the toothbrush within a specified short time following termination of a normal brushing event to provide the user a specified additional time, e.g. 30 seconds of toothbrush action. A special toothbrush interface arrangement includes a display (80) which encourages children to maintain brushing for the full brushing period. This is accomplished through sequential illustration of the progress of an article from an initial state to a final desired state as the toothbrush is used for increasing portions of a full brushing time period.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 5, 2014Publication date: October 30, 2014Applicant: KONINKLIJKE PHILIPS N.V.Inventors: CHARLES B. Patent number: 8868250Abstract: In one implementation, an environmental controller operates a cooling system in an electronic device. The environmental controller includes a closed loop control system for operating a cooling fan at a target speed. The environmental controller may select the target speed based on one or more temperature sensors. The environmental controller may select the target speed based on the speeds of additional fans or the fans may be controlled in unison. The closed loop control system includes a proportional weight. When a measured cooling fan speed deviates from the target speed by more than a threshold error value, the proportional weight is constant. As the measured cooling fan speed approaches the target speed, and the threshold error value is crossed, the proportional weight is variable. The variance may be a function of time such as a periodic stair step function.Type: GrantFiled: September 28, 2010Date of Patent: October 21, 2014Assignee: Cisco Technology, Inc.Inventors: Niels-Peder Mosegaard Jensen, Joseph Dean Jaoudi

Publication number: 20140305238Abstract: An actuator includes a ball nut, a ball screw, and a ball screw stop. The ball nut is adapted to receive an input torque and in response rotates and supplies a drive force. The ball screw extends through the ball nut and has a first end and a second end. The ball screw receives the drive force from the ball nut and in response selectively translates between a retract position and a extend position. The ball screw stop is mounted on the ball screw proximate the first end to translate therewith. The ball screw stop engages the ball nut when the ball screw is in the extend position, translates, with compliance, a predetermined distance toward the first end upon engaging the ball nut, and prevents further rotation of the ball screw upon translating the predetermined distance.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 6, 2013Publication date: October 16, 2014Applicant: Honeywell International Inc.Inventors: Paul T. Publication number: 20140277748Abstract: An energy management system having a centralized site controller is provided with thermostats in multiple zones, each thermostat having the capability of acting as a remote terminal to the controller. Each thermostat provides an interface to the site controller while simultaneously acting as the thermostat for each zone. The thermostat displays information concerning the state of the building's lighting and HVAC systems for any zone and allows the local user to initiate local overrides of set points. The central site controller determines how many thermostats are enabled with a terminal mode, including the full extent of their read and write permissions on other zones. The override requests are received by the central controller and merged with the settings for the current control algorithms. After a preconfigured time, the central controller reinstates the current control algorithm.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 15, 2013Publication date: September 18, 2014Inventor: Daniel K. Dyess
